public class DwcaTaxonRecord extends DwcaRecordBase
COLLECTION_SEPARATOR, config, count, IS_FIRST, IS_NOT_FIRST, isWritingHeader, knownFields, knownTermFields
Constructor and Description |
---|
DwcaTaxonRecord(DwcaMetaDataRecord metaDataRecord,
DwcaTaxExportConfigurator config) |
Modifier and Type | Method and Description |
---|---|
protected void |
doWrite(DwcaTaxExportState state,
java.io.PrintWriter writer) |
java.lang.String |
getAcceptedNameUsage() |
java.util.UUID |
getAcceptedNameUsageId() |
java.lang.String |
getAccessRights() |
java.lang.String |
getBibliographicCitation() |
java.lang.String |
getClazz() |
java.lang.String |
getDatasetId() |
java.lang.String |
getDatasetName() |
java.lang.String |
getFamily() |
java.lang.String |
getGenus() |
java.lang.String |
getGenusPart() |
java.lang.String |
getHigherClassification() |
java.lang.String |
getInformationWithheld() |
java.lang.String |
getInfraGenericEpithet() |
java.lang.String |
getInfraspecificEpithet() |
java.lang.String |
getKingdom() |
Language |
getLanguage() |
org.joda.time.DateTime |
getModified() |
java.lang.String |
getNameAccordingTo() |
java.lang.Object |
getNameAccordingToId() |
java.lang.String |
getNamePublishedIn() |
java.lang.Object |
getNamePublishedInId() |
NomenclaturalCode |
getNomenclaturalCode() |
NomenclaturalStatusType |
getNomenclaturalStatus() |
java.lang.String |
getOrder() |
java.lang.String |
getOriginalNameUsage() |
java.util.UUID |
getOriginalNameUsageId() |
java.lang.String |
getParentNameUsage() |
java.util.UUID |
getParentNameUsageId() |
java.lang.String |
getPhylum() |
java.util.Set<Rights> |
getRights() |
java.lang.String |
getRightsHolder() |
java.lang.String |
getScientificName() |
java.lang.String |
getScientificNameAuthorship() |
java.lang.String |
getScientificNameId() |
java.lang.String |
getSource() |
java.lang.String |
getSpecificEpithet() |
java.lang.String |
getSubgenus() |
java.util.UUID |
getTaxonConceptId() |
java.lang.String |
getTaxonomicStatus() |
Rank |
getTaxonRank() |
java.lang.String |
getTaxonRemarks() |
java.lang.String |
getUninomial() |
java.lang.String |
getVerbatimTaxonRank() |
java.lang.String |
getVernacularName() |
protected void |
registerKnownFields() |
void |
setAcceptedNameUsage(java.lang.String acceptedNameUsage) |
void |
setAcceptedNameUsageId(java.util.UUID acceptedNameUsageId) |
void |
setAccessRights(java.lang.String accessRights) |
void |
setBibliographicCitation(java.lang.String bibliographicCitation) |
void |
setClazz(java.lang.String clazz) |
void |
setDatasetId(Classification classification) |
void |
setDatasetName(java.lang.String datasetName) |
void |
setFamily(java.lang.String family) |
void |
setGenus(java.lang.String genus) |
void |
setGenusPart(java.lang.String genusPart) |
void |
setHigherClassification(java.lang.String higherClassification) |
void |
setInformationWithheld(java.lang.String informationWithheld) |
void |
setInfraGenericEpithet(java.lang.String infraGenericEpithet) |
void |
setInfraspecificEpithet(java.lang.String infraspecificEpithet) |
void |
setKingdom(java.lang.String kingdom) |
void |
setLanguage(Language language) |
void |
setModified(org.joda.time.DateTime modified) |
void |
setNameAccordingTo(java.lang.String nameAccordingTo) |
void |
setNameAccordingToId(java.util.UUID nameAccordingToId) |
void |
setNamePublishedIn(java.lang.String namePublishedIn) |
void |
setNamePublishedInId(java.util.UUID namePublishedInId) |
void |
setNomenclaturalCode(NomenclaturalCode nomenclaturalCode) |
void |
setNomenclaturalStatus(NomenclaturalStatusType nomenclaturalStatus) |
void |
setOrder(java.lang.String order) |
void |
setOriginalNameUsage(java.lang.String originalNameUsage) |
void |
setOriginalNameUsageId(java.util.UUID originalNameUsageId) |
void |
setParentNameUsage(java.lang.String parentNameUsage) |
void |
setParentNameUsageId(java.util.UUID parentNameUsageId) |
void |
setPhylum(java.lang.String phylum) |
void |
setRights(java.util.Set<Rights> rights) |
void |
setRightsHolder(java.lang.String rightsHolder) |
void |
setScientificName(java.lang.String scientificName) |
void |
setScientificNameAuthorship(java.lang.String scientificNameAuthorship) |
void |
setScientificNameId(DwcaId scientificNameId) |
void |
setScientificNameId(TaxonName scientificNameId) |
void |
setSource(java.lang.String source) |
void |
setSpecificEpithet(java.lang.String specificEpithet) |
void |
setSubgenus(java.lang.String subgenus) |
void |
setTaxonConceptId(java.util.UUID taxonConceptId) |
void |
setTaxonomicStatus(java.lang.String taxonomicStatus) |
void |
setTaxonRank(Rank taxonRank) |
void |
setTaxonRemarks(java.lang.String taxonRemarks) |
void |
setUninomial(java.lang.String uninomial) |
void |
setVerbatimTaxonRank(java.lang.String verbatimTaxonRank) |
void |
setVernacularName(java.lang.String vernacularName) |
void |
writeCsv(DwcaTaxExportState state) |
addKnownField, addKnownField, getAgent, getDate, getDesignationType, getEstablishmentMeans, getFeature, getId, getId, getLanguage, getLifeStage, getNomCode, getNomStatus, getOccurrenceStatus, getRank, getRights, getRights, getSex, getTimePeriod, getTimePeriodPart, getUuid, line, line, line, line, line, line,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, print, printId, printId, printNotes, printNotes, registerFieldKey, setId, setUuid, write
public DwcaTaxonRecord(DwcaMetaDataRecord metaDataRecord, DwcaTaxExportConfigurator config)
protected void registerKnownFields()
registerKnownFields
in class DwcaRecordBase
public void writeCsv(DwcaTaxExportState state)
writeCsv
in class DwcaRecordBase
protected void doWrite(DwcaTaxExportState state, java.io.PrintWriter writer)
doWrite
in class DwcaRecordBase
public java.lang.String getScientificNameId()
public void setScientificNameId(TaxonName scientificNameId)
public java.util.UUID getAcceptedNameUsageId()
public void setAcceptedNameUsageId(java.util.UUID acceptedNameUsageId)
public java.util.UUID getParentNameUsageId()
public void setParentNameUsageId(java.util.UUID parentNameUsageId)
public java.util.UUID getOriginalNameUsageId()
public void setOriginalNameUsageId(java.util.UUID originalNameUsageId)
public java.lang.Object getNameAccordingToId()
public void setNameAccordingToId(java.util.UUID nameAccordingToId)
public java.lang.Object getNamePublishedInId()
public void setNamePublishedInId(java.util.UUID namePublishedInId)
public java.util.UUID getTaxonConceptId()
public void setTaxonConceptId(java.util.UUID taxonConceptId)
public java.lang.String getScientificName()
public void setScientificName(java.lang.String scientificName)
public java.lang.String getAcceptedNameUsage()
public void setAcceptedNameUsage(java.lang.String acceptedNameUsage)
public java.lang.String getParentNameUsage()
public void setParentNameUsage(java.lang.String parentNameUsage)
public java.lang.String getOriginalNameUsage()
public void setOriginalNameUsage(java.lang.String originalNameUsage)
public java.lang.String getNameAccordingTo()
public void setNameAccordingTo(java.lang.String nameAccordingTo)
public java.lang.String getNamePublishedIn()
public void setNamePublishedIn(java.lang.String namePublishedIn)
public java.lang.String getHigherClassification()
public void setHigherClassification(java.lang.String higherClassification)
public Rank getTaxonRank()
public void setTaxonRank(Rank taxonRank)
public java.lang.String getVerbatimTaxonRank()
public void setVerbatimTaxonRank(java.lang.String verbatimTaxonRank)
public java.lang.String getScientificNameAuthorship()
public void setScientificNameAuthorship(java.lang.String scientificNameAuthorship)
public java.lang.String getVernacularName()
public void setVernacularName(java.lang.String vernacularName)
public NomenclaturalCode getNomenclaturalCode()
public void setNomenclaturalCode(NomenclaturalCode nomenclaturalCode)
public java.lang.String getTaxonomicStatus()
public void setTaxonomicStatus(java.lang.String taxonomicStatus)
public NomenclaturalStatusType getNomenclaturalStatus()
public void setNomenclaturalStatus(NomenclaturalStatusType nomenclaturalStatus)
public java.lang.String getTaxonRemarks()
public void setTaxonRemarks(java.lang.String taxonRemarks)
public org.joda.time.DateTime getModified()
public void setModified(org.joda.time.DateTime modified)
public Language getLanguage()
public void setLanguage(Language language)
public java.util.Set<Rights> getRights()
public void setRights(java.util.Set<Rights> rights)
public java.lang.String getRightsHolder()
public void setRightsHolder(java.lang.String rightsHolder)
public java.lang.String getAccessRights()
public void setAccessRights(java.lang.String accessRights)
public java.lang.String getBibliographicCitation()
public void setBibliographicCitation(java.lang.String bibliographicCitation)
public java.lang.String getInformationWithheld()
public void setInformationWithheld(java.lang.String informationWithheld)
public java.lang.String getDatasetId()
public void setDatasetId(Classification classification)
public java.lang.String getDatasetName()
public void setDatasetName(java.lang.String datasetName)
public java.lang.String getSource()
public void setSource(java.lang.String source)
public java.lang.String getKingdom()
public void setKingdom(java.lang.String kingdom)
public java.lang.String getPhylum()
public void setPhylum(java.lang.String phylum)
public java.lang.String getClazz()
public void setClazz(java.lang.String clazz)
public java.lang.String getOrder()
public void setOrder(java.lang.String order)
public java.lang.String getFamily()
public void setFamily(java.lang.String family)
public java.lang.String getGenus()
public void setGenus(java.lang.String genus)
public java.lang.String getSubgenus()
public void setSubgenus(java.lang.String subgenus)
public java.lang.String getSpecificEpithet()
public void setSpecificEpithet(java.lang.String specificEpithet)
public java.lang.String getInfraspecificEpithet()
public void setInfraspecificEpithet(java.lang.String infraspecificEpithet)
public java.lang.String getUninomial()
public void setUninomial(java.lang.String uninomial)
public java.lang.String getInfraGenericEpithet()
public void setInfraGenericEpithet(java.lang.String infraGenericEpithet)
public void setScientificNameId(DwcaId scientificNameId)
public java.lang.String getGenusPart()
public void setGenusPart(java.lang.String genusPart)
Copyright © 2007-2020 EDIT. All Rights Reserved.